Margie Krebsbach hopes that a trip to Rome will inspire her husband Carl to make love to her. However, she finds a patriotic purpose for the trip as well: a Lake Wobegon boy died in Rome in 1944, and his grave is in a neglected weed patch near the Coliseum. But what begins as a trip for two turns into a modern-day Canterbury Tales.
